NewEdge Wealth LLC Cuts Stock Position in Pfizer Inc. $PFE

NewEdge Wealth LLC trimmed its holdings in shares of Pfizer Inc. (NYSE:PFEFree Report) by 24.6% in the 1st quarter, according to the company in its most recent 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The firm owned 81,237 shares of the biopharmaceutical company’s stock after selling 26,519 shares during the quarter. NewEdge Wealth LLC’s holdings in Pfizer were worth $2,281,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Pfizer Price Performance

PFE stock opened at $24.52 on Friday. Pfizer Inc. has a 1 year low of $23.11 and a 1 year high of $28.75.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.67, a current ratio of 1.25 and a quick ratio of 0.94. The firm has a market capitalization of $139.78 billion, a PE ratio of 18.72 and a beta of 0.35. The business has a 50 day simple moving average of $25.11 and a 200-day simple moving average of $26.16.

Pfizer (NYSE:PFEGet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ings data on Tuesday, May 5th. The biopharmaceutical company reported $0.75 EPS for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.72 by $0.03. The firm had revenue of $14.45 billion for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$13.84 billion. Pfizer had a return on equity of 19.44% and a net margin of 11.83%.The firm’s revenue was up 5.4%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ter last year, the business posted $0.92 earnings per share. Pfizer has set its FY 2026 guidance at 2.800-3.000 EPS. Equities research analysts anticipate that Pfizer Inc. will post 2.96 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Pfizer Announces Dividend

The business also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Tuesday, September 1st. Stockholders of record on Friday, July 24th will be issued a dividend of $0.43 per share. This represents a $1.72 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 7.0%. The ex-dividend date is Friday, July 24th. Pfizer’s payout ratio is currently 131.30%.

Pfizer Inc (NYSE: PFE) is a multinational biopharmaceutical company headquartered in New York City. Founded in 1849 by Charles Pfizer and Charles Erhart, the company researches, develops, manufactures and commercializes a broad range of medicines and vaccines for human health. Its activities span discovery research, clinical development, regulatory affairs, manufacturing and global commercial distribution across multiple therapeutic areas.

Pfizer’s portfolio and pipeline cover oncology, immunology, cardiology, endocrinology, rare diseases, hospital acute care and anti-infectives, along with a substantial vaccine business.
